Executive function coaching teaches students how to organize, plan, prioritize, manage time, maintain focus, self-assess, and study efficiently. Self-management skills are increasingly important in a complex world with many distractions and competing priorities. People who learn these skills are better equipped to navigate the challenges of school and adult life.

What is executive functioning coaching?

Through the use of research-based strategies, we work as a team to design a personalized program to help clients with goal-setting, time management, study skills, and more. I help clients create the change that they want, or need, in their academic lives so that their academic outcomes reflect their potential.

Clients work with me to develop personalized strategies best suited to achieve their individual goals and address their individual challenges.

Skills like planning, prioritizing, scheduling, task initiation, sustaining focus, personal management, and balancing daily responsibilities with long term goals are developed during private 1-on-1 sessions.

I access organizational systems used by the schools and the client to ensure they are staying on top of assignments, aware of upcoming responsibilities, and prioritize for success.
